Closed tender

FCC/392/25 Contract hire of sweepers in 4 lots for Fingal County Council

Details

Value
EUR 4,000,000
Topic
Road sweepers
Published
20 November 2025
Submission
19 December 2025

Tender description

Fingal County Council seeks Lease hire with maintenance of the following: Lot 1: 8 to 9 New 1.5 cu. meter (nominal) Compact Road Sweepers on a hire contract to include maintenance over a period of three (3) years  Lot 2: 3 to 4 New 1 cu. meter (nominal) Subcompact Compact Road Sweepers on a hire contract to include maintenance over a period of three (3) years   Lot 3: 5 to 6 New 6.5 cu. meter (nominal) road sweepers on a hire contract to include maintenance over a period of five (5) years   Lot 4: 1 to 2 New 4 cu. meter (nominal) road sweepers on a hire contract to include maintenance over a period of five (5) years
